1. Latte Makeup — But Make It Office-Friendly

The “latte makeup” trend exploded on TikTok thanks to its warm, bronzy tones that mimic the creamy shades of your favorite coffee drink.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Eyes: Use matte caramel or soft bronze eyeshadow all over the lid, blending softly into the crease.
  • Face: Lightly bronze the perimeter of your face — think sun-kissed, not heavy contour.
  • Lips: A nude lip liner topped with a beige gloss keeps the look chic and understated.

Pro tip: Swap any glittery shadow for satin or matte finishes for a more professional vibe.


2. Cloud Skin — The Soft-Matte Glow

“Cloud skin” is the dreamy in-between: not flat matte, not overly dewy — just a smooth, blurred finish that looks like your skin, but better.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Start with a hydrating primer to create a smooth base.
  • Apply a lightweight, medium-coverage foundation.
  • Lightly set with a soft-focus powder (only on oily areas like T-zone).
  • Add a subtle cream blush for a natural flush.

Pro tip: Use a damp beauty sponge to press powder into the skin for that diffused, cloud-like effect.


3. Cherry Cola Lips — A Subtle Twist on a Bold Lip

This trend combines deep cherry reds with a hint of brown, inspired by — you guessed it — the fizzy drink.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Line lips with a deep brown liner.
  • Apply a cherry-red lipstick in the center and blend into the liner for a gradient effect.
  • Top with a clear or lightly tinted gloss for dimension.

Pro tip: Keep eye makeup minimal so the lips can shine.


4. White or Nude Eyeliner for Wide-Awake Eyes

TikTok loves the doll-like effect of white eyeliner in the waterline, but in real life, pure white can be too stark.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Use a nude or cream pencil instead — it brightens without looking obvious.
  • Pair with a soft lash curl and light mascara for fresh, open eyes.

Pro tip: Avoid lining the entire top lid in white unless you’re going for an editorial photoshoot.


5. Douyin-Inspired Blush Placement

Douyin (Chinese TikTok) makeup trends are known for strategic blush placement to create a sweet, youthful look.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Apply blush high on the apples of your cheeks, blending slightly under the eyes.
  • Choose shades like soft pink or peach for a natural flush.
  • Skip overly shimmery blush to keep it wearable.

Pro tip: Cream blush blends seamlessly and looks more skin-like.


6. Faux Freckles — Keep It Subtle

Faux freckles add charm, but heavy, dark dots can look cartoonish in person.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Use a fine-tipped brow pen or freckle pen to dot lightly over the nose and upper cheeks.
  • Tap with your finger to blend them into your skin for a natural look.

Pro tip: Less is more — you can always add more, but removing them mid-day is tricky.


7. Monochromatic Makeup for Effortless Coordination

TikTok has embraced the one-color look: matching your eyeshadow, blush, and lips.
How to wear it IRL:

  • Pick a flattering tone like dusty rose, coral, or mauve.
  • Keep intensity balanced — for example, soft eyeshadow, medium blush, and a satin lip.
  • Avoid going too bold in all areas to keep it sophisticated.

Pro tip: Cream formulas blend best for a seamless monochrome effect.


General Tips for Making TikTok Makeup Wearable

  • Tone down shimmer & glitter for daily wear — save high-impact sparkle for nights out.
  • Blend, blend, blend — harsh lines look less forgiving in daylight.
  • Balance the look — if eyes are bold, keep lips soft (and vice versa).
  • Adapt to your environment — office, school, or casual outings all have different thresholds for boldness.
